Part of the brand-new Magic World Family Entertainment Center, the retail destination reflects a resurgence of fandom for Teletubbies and In the Night Garden in China


Zhongshan, China – July 7, 2026 – WildBrain, a global leader in family entertainment, is bringing its beloved Teletubbies and In the Night Garden preschool franchises to life in Zhongshan, China, with the debut of WildBrain Garden—a new themed retail destination.


Reflecting a resurgence of fandom for Teletubbies and In the Night Garden in China, this is the first-ever permanent retail store dedicated to WildBrain’s franchises in the region. WildBrain Garden is a 930 sq. ft., playfully designed themed retail environment featuring a curated selection of Teletubbies and In the Night Garden merchandise, including collectibles, accessories, gifting and plush.

Opened on June 27, as part of Magic World Family Entertainment Center (FEC)—one of Asia’s largest international IP-themed clusters created to engage families with world-class entertainment brands—WildBrain Garden delighted fans as they stepped into the whimsical worlds of these two iconic brands for a unique shopping experience.


WildBrain Garden was developed in partnership with Max-Matching Entertainments Co. Ltd.—a leading developer, investor and operator of international cultural and IP visitor attractions—alongside the dedicated Location-Based Entertainment (LBE) team of WildBrain’s global licensing agency, WildBrain CPLG.


Colorful store display of Teletubbies plush toys and boxed figures, with red, yellow, green, and purple characters on green shelves

Coming as Teletubbies prepares to celebrate its 30th anniversary in 2027, and In the Night Garden’s 20th, the launch represents the first of two WildBrain Garden retail concepts planned in China under the Max-Matching partnership, with a second opening in Beijing in 2027.

About WildBrain’s Teletubbies


WildBrain's Teletubbies have been saying “EH-OH!” and delighting preschoolers and families around the world since 1997, becoming one of the most recognizable and enduring children's brands of all time. Through the playful adventures of Tinky Winky, Dipsy, Laa-Laa and Po, the brand inspires curiosity, imagination and early learning while encouraging social, emotional, cognitive and physical development. Today, the Teletubbies continue to connect with audiences across every screen through new content on platforms like Netflix, an expansive global footprint on YouTube and FAST, with over 30 channels on each, and millions of followers on social media. Beyond entertainment, the brand has evolved into a global lifestyle franchise, with collaborations, consumer products and experiences spanning apparel, accessories, plush, collectibles, beauty and more. Beloved by children, embraced by nostalgic fans and celebrated across pop culture, this colourful quartet continues to engage audiences of all ages through fresh storytelling, immersive experiences and meaningful brand partnerships. About WildBrain’s In the Night Garden


WildBrain’s In the Night Garden is an enchanting preschool brand that has helped families wind down at bedtime for nearly two decades. Filled with magical stories, gentle humour, memorable music and beloved characters, including Igglepiggle, Upsy Daisy and Makka Pakka, the series invites children aged 6 months+ into a calming world of imagination and discovery. With licensed product across toy, collectibles, publishing and apparel, 100 live-action episodes, six CG-animated ZinkyZzzonk specials, an ongoing home on CBeebies and more than one million YouTube subscribers, In the Night Garden continues to delight a new generation of young fans around the world.
